juniper/juniper_actix
Mihai Dinculescu 8d7ba8295c
Impl subscriptions for juniper_actix (#716)
* Impl subscriptions for juniper_actix

* Add random_human example subscription

* Add actix_subscriptions example to CI

* fixup! Add random_human example subscription

* Migrate actix subscriptions to juniper_graphql_ws

* Simplify error handling

* Change unwrap to expect

* Close connection on server serialization error

Co-authored-by: Christian Legnitto <LegNeato@users.noreply.github.com>
2020-08-09 12:19:34 -10:00
..
examples Move starwars schema into fixture directory (#694) 2020-07-15 21:46:37 -10:00
src Impl subscriptions for juniper_actix (#716) 2020-08-09 12:19:34 -10:00
.gitignore Add actix-web integration (#603) 2020-04-20 20:21:02 -10:00
Cargo.toml Impl subscriptions for juniper_actix (#716) 2020-08-09 12:19:34 -10:00
CHANGELOG.md Impl subscriptions for juniper_actix (#716) 2020-08-09 12:19:34 -10:00
LICENSE Add actix-web integration (#603) 2020-04-20 20:21:02 -10:00
README.md Add actix-web integration (#603) 2020-04-20 20:21:02 -10:00

juniper_actix

This repository contains the actix web server integration for Juniper, a GraphQL implementation for Rust, its inspired and some parts are copied from juniper_warp.

Documentation

For documentation, including guides and examples, check out Juniper.

A basic usage example can also be found in the API documentation.

Examples

Check examples/actix_server for example code of a working actix server with GraphQL handlers.

License

This project is under the BSD-2 license.

Check the LICENSE file for details.